प्रश्न
Evaluate the following.
`int 1/(sqrt("x"^2 -8"x" - 20))` dx

उत्तर
Let I = `int 1/(sqrt("x"^2 -8"x" - 20))` dx
`= int 1/(sqrt ("x"^2 - 2 * 4"x" + 16 - 16 - 20))` dx
`= int "dx"/sqrt(("x - 4")^2 - 36)` dx
`= int "dx"/(sqrt(("x - 4")^2 - 6^2))` dx
`= log |("x - 4") + sqrt(("x - 4")^2 - 6^2)|` + c
∴ I = `log |("x - 4") + sqrt("x"^2 - 8"x" - 20)|` + c
